    Freegle/freecycle wire and plastic ones. eBay wooden or fabric ones. I always get lots of takers for wire and plastic ones when I offer them. Dry cleaners also take their own plastic ones back, and usually wire ones as well.

    Let’s try to start the week in a really positive way. If you have never read the book Pollyanna then you’ve missed a real treat! If you have you will know the idea. Today I want you to play Pollyanna:

    Pollyanna's philosophy of life centres on what she calls "The Glad Game", an optimistic attitude she learned from her father. The game consists of finding something to be glad about in every situation. It originated in an incident one Christmas when Pollyanna, who was hoping for a doll in the missionary barrel, found only a pair of crutches inside. Making the game up on the spot, Pollyanna's father taught her to look at the good side of things—in this case, to be glad about the crutches because "we didn't need to use them!"
